ELISA Kit PrincipleThe test principle applied in this kit is Sandwich enzyme immunoassay. The microtiter plate provided in this kit has been pre-coated with an antibody specific to Growth Factor, Augmenter Of Liver Regeneration (GFER). Standards or samples are then added to the appropriate microtiter plate wells with a biotin-conjugated antibody specific to Growth Factor, Augmenter Of Liver Regeneration (GFER). Next, Avidin conjugated to Horseradish Peroxidase (HRP) is added to each microplate well and incubated. After TMB substrate solution is added, only those wells that contain Growth Factor, Augmenter Of Liver Regeneration (GFER), biotin-conjugated antibody and enzyme-conjugated Avidin will exhibit a change in color. The enzyme-substrate reaction is terminated by the addition of sulphuric acid solution and the color change is measured spectrophotometrically at a wavelength of 450nm +/- 10nm. The concentration of Growth Factor, Augmenter Of Liver Regeneration (GFER) in the samples is then determined by comparing the O.D. of the samples to the standard curve.

Description of TargetFAD-dependent sulfhydryl oxidase that regenerates the redox-active disulfide bonds in CHCHD4/MIA40, a chaperone essential for disulfide bond formation and protein folding in the mitochondrial intermembrane space. The reduced form of CHCHD4/MIA40 forms a transient intermolecular disulfide bridge with GFER/ERV1, resulting in regeneration of the essential disulfide bonds in CHCHD4/MIA40, while GFER/ERV1 becomes re-oxidized by donating electrons to cytochrome c or molecular oxygen (By similarity).
